Frame Model Lineup

Rambler
Equipped with a segmental steel fork, this bike has a slightly longer trail and higher bottom bracket height than the Rambler SL, making it better suited for off-road touring.
With features like a fork designed for a dynamo route and other thoughtful details essential for touring, this bike truly reflects the builder’s passion for cycling.

Rambler SL
Equipped with a gravel carbon fork featuring the rare 1-1/8" straight steerer tube, the Rambler SL is recommended for riders who want to seriously enjoy the fun side of cycling rather than competing.
Its quick and aggressive geometry enables high-speed and long-distance gravel riding.

Supertramp
A bike designed for flat-bar-style bikepacking.
The frame accommodates tires up to 29x2.6" and comes pre-equipped with mounts for any rack, accessory, or bag.
It can go anywhere and do anything.If you’re someone who will own only one bike in your lifetime and are looking for a bike that lets you explore the possibilities of cycling, the Supertramp is the best choice.

Dark Star
The Dark Star is a premium steel hardtail trail bike featuring sliding dropouts. Its geometry strikes a balance between playfulness, speed, and fun, and it is compatible with suspension forks offering 120mm or 130mm of travel.
Characterized by a nimble and responsive ride, it can truly be called an all-around MTB.

Spelljammer
The Spelljammer is a reinterpretation of the classic randonneur bike through the lens of WILDE.
Based on Jeff’s deep respect for the legendary bikes of the past—an essential part of his legacy—this model blends elements of modern gravel bikes. It is designed to efficiently navigate both paved and unpaved roads while reliably carrying the gear needed for long-distance rides.

Moto-Cruiser
The Moto-Cruiser is Jeff’s modern reinterpretation of the classic 26-inch MTBs he loves.
Cruise through the city, head out onto the trails, and wander down any side street that catches your eye. It reminds you of the roots of that carefree, playful cycling experience.
26-inch wheels, rim brakes, loop tail.
